Surface preparation is key to optimal adhesion.
Ensure surfaces are clean, dry, and free of dust, grease, and loose particles.
Sanding smooth surfaces can also improve adhesion.
Follow these steps for proper application:
Pro Tip: For optimal curing, maintain a temperature between 60°F and 80°F (15°C and 27°C). High humidity can also affect the curing time, so ensure adequate ventilation. If you're working in colder conditions, consider using a heat lamp to accelerate the curing process. Always refer to the manufacturer's instructions for specific curing times.
To ensure a strong bond, apply even pressure to the bonded surfaces.
Use clamps or supports to hold the materials in place while the adhesive cures.
Allow sufficient curing time as recommended by the manufacturer.

The Safety Data Sheet (SDS) provides important information about the product's hazards and safety measures.
Review the SDS before using mitch construction paste to understand potential risks.
It includes details on handling, storage, and emergency procedures.
Work in a well-ventilated area to avoid inhaling fumes.
Wear gloves and eye protection to prevent skin and eye contact.
Consider using a respirator if ventilation is limited.
In case of skin contact, wash thoroughly with soap and water.
If eye contact occurs, flush with water for 15 minutes and seek medical attention.
If inhaled, move to fresh air. If symptoms persist, consult a doctor.

Weak bonds can result from improper surface preparation or insufficient adhesive.
Ensure surfaces are clean and dry before application.
Apply enough mitch construction paste to create a strong bond.
Curing issues can occur if the adhesive is exposed to extreme temperatures or humidity.
Follow the manufacturer's recommendations for curing time and environmental conditions.
Ensure adequate ventilation during the curing process.
Store in a cool, dry place away from direct sunlight.
Seal the container tightly after each use to prevent drying out.
Check the expiration date before use to ensure optimal performance.

Proper surface preparation is critical to ensure a strong and lasting bond with mitch construction paste.
Start by cleaning the surfaces thoroughly to remove any dust, dirt, grease, or loose particles.
For smooth surfaces, consider sanding them lightly to create a better grip for the adhesive.
Make sure the surfaces are completely dry before applying the paste; moisture can compromise the bond strength. For example, if you're working with metal, use a degreaser to remove any oil residue.
When working with mitch construction paste, safety should always be a priority.
Always work in a well-ventilated area to avoid inhaling fumes, which can cause respiratory irritation.
Wear gloves to prevent skin contact, as the adhesive can cause irritation or allergic reactions in some individuals.
Eye protection, such as safety glasses or goggles, is also essential to prevent accidental splashes. If you experience any adverse reactions, consult the Safety Data Sheet (SDS) and seek medical attention if necessary.
Yes, mitch construction paste is generally suitable for both indoor and outdoor applications due to its water-resistant properties.
However, it's essential to check the product specifications to ensure it's rated for the specific environmental conditions it will be exposed to.
For example, some formulations may be more resistant to extreme temperatures or UV exposure than others.
Always follow the manufacturer's recommendations for optimal performance and longevity in outdoor settings.
A weak bond with mitch construction paste can manifest as separation between bonded materials, movement or instability of the joint, or a lack of resistance to applied force.
To address this, first ensure that the surfaces were properly prepared and clean before application.
If the bond is already weak, you may need to remove the old adhesive, re-prepare the surfaces, and apply a fresh layer of mitch construction paste, ensuring even pressure and adequate curing time.
Using clamps or supports during the curing process can also help strengthen the bond.
